Unjustified Absences
Something that was in the news last week was the topic of taking children out of school for holidays and other such activities. (Read article here.) The research clearly states that children who attend school as required are more likely to succeed. (Read a NZ research study here.)
Each child's attendances and absences are recorded and coded in our electronic system for the Ministry of Education. A couple of times a year I report to the Board of Trustees on our attendance rate. The Ministry regularly collects this information from samples of schools, and just yesterday has requested our current information.
As a school I believe that we have a high rate of 'Truant/Unjustified Absences' - currently sitting at nearly 4%. While 4% doesn't sound a lot - it equates to 4 children EVERY day being away unjustifiably.
Justified reasons equate to illnesses, medical appointments, family bereavements and similar such needs. Should for some reason you need to take your child/ren away from school for something other than a justified reason, then we would appreciate either an email or a letter to the office so that we can file this in our attendance records, as we are also regularly audited by the Ministry on our attendance records.
